July 20, 2006 - A home in Isles de Jean Charles, Louisiana, a bayou community hard-hit by Hurricane Rita. Photos provided by Courtney Pellegrin-Howell.


This family received several pieces of furniture from a recent Orphan Grain Train relief shipment to Houma, La., including this sofa. All their old furniture had to be thrown out due to water damage. They have used up all the funds they received from FEMA for repairing their house, but as the following pictures show, there is much left to be done.

The kitchen cabinets have yet to be torn out, and are full of mold.

Another angle in the kitchen. The steps to the front of the house ended up in a field out back, and were discovered via boat.

The house is four feet off the ground and was filled with 2 1/2 feet of water for 14 days.


A look at the half-repaired master bedroom.
